European space lander left crater on surface of Mars in crash-landing

Friday, October 28, 2016 - 05:21 in Astronomy & Space

FRANKFURT (Reuters) - Images taken by a NASA Mars orbiter indicate that Europe's ill-fated Mars lander left a small crater on the Red Planet's surface, backing up scientists' theory that the craft hit the ground at high speed.
